    • Separating hype from fact, this text investigates the fate of embodiment in an information age. It relates three issues: information as an entity separate from the material forms that carry it; the construction of the Cyborg; and the dismantling of the humanist subject in cybernetic discourse.

      Focusing on the evolution of electronic literature, N. Katherine Hayles presents a comprehensive survey that examines its genres and challenges to traditional literary theory. She argues for a new understanding that integrates both print and digital texts, emphasizing the interplay between humans and technology. Through close readings of significant works, Hayles highlights emerging narrative modes and the digital origins of contemporary literature. Accompanied by a CD of diverse electronic literature and a supportive website for educators, this book serves as a vital resource for integrating electronic literature into academic settings.

      N. Katherine Hayles traces the emergence of what she identifies as the postprint condition, exploring how the interweaving of print and digital technologies has changed not only books but also language, authorship, and what it means to be human.

      Addressing the urgent need for global action against environmental collapse, the author critiques human hubris and anthropocentrism as key contributors to current crises. By proposing an integrated cognitive framework (ICF), the book explores the interconnectedness of humans, nonhuman lifeforms, and artificial intelligence. Through case studies on gene editing, autopoiesis, and Gaia theory, it examines how these elements interact to foster both risks and opportunities, advocating for a positive path forward that considers the broader ecological context.
